IQOS authorised as Modified Risk Tobacco Product

Philip Morris' IQOS Tobacco Heating System has become the second ever product to be authorised as a MRTP by the US Food and Drug Administration, according to a press release by the FDA.

IQOS and the accompanying Marlboro Heatsticks also became the first tobacco product range to receive “exposure modification” orders which “permits the marketing of a product as containing a reduced level of or presenting a reduced exposure to a substance or as being free of a substance when the issuance of the order is expected to benefit the health of the population,” according to the FDA.
The IQOS device heats tobacco-filled sticks and generates an aerosol containing nicotine. Data submitted to the FDA shows that marketing IQOS products as an MRTP could help addicted adult smokers move away from combustible cigarettes and ultimately reduce exposure to harmful chemicals, according to the FDA. The FDA will closely follow up on how IQOS will continue to be marketed and make sure the products do not lead to an increase in us among youths.
“We’re delighted that the FDA authorized IQOS to be marketed as a modified-risk tobacco product. This authorization gives PM USA an opportunity to communicate additional benefits of switching to IQOS and this decision is an important step for adult smokers,” said Billy Gifford, Chief Executive Officer of Altria. “IQOS is a key part of that future as we develop our portfolio of FDA-authorized, non-combustible products and actively switch adult smokers to them.”
